THE POSITION

The HR Operations Specialist provides primary customer support to employees and HR team members with regards to personnel actions, organizational changes and payroll. The position is responsible for management of personnel data and reporting within the SAP HR system, SuccessFactors’s Employee Central, Ceridian Dayforce and other ancillary HR systems / tools. Additionally, the HR Operations Specialist will have responsibility for a designated specialty area(s) such as Relocation, KPI tracking, Data Replication, International Assignments, Unemployment Insurance Administration, Time & Attendance, etc. Payroll responsible for Chatham location Provide basic coaching to management acting as HR Generalist and ensures timely, effective execution of all local operational HR related work ( onboarding and placement, transfer and separation, local organizational communications, employee relations, HR KPI’s and monthly reporting) Interacts with customers in person, via teams, electronic mail, or service tickets to answer questions and provide assistance in the completion of standardized HR transactions Responds to and provides direction to employees on human relation issues such as employee concerns, benefit inquiries, harassment and discrimination complaints Documents all contacts, interactions and outcomes within the Ticket Management software Continuously monitors quality and quick turnover of performed tasks and ensures high quality Inputs and audits required data into the HR system for maintaining; payroll, organizational management, recruiting, Global HR System, etc. Performs complex data maintenance of personnel master data within the SuccessFactors’s Employee Central systems, SAP HR and Ceridian Dayforce Uses independent judgement and available resources to determine appropriate methods for recording actions and ensuring data integrity Receives employee and HR inquiries regarding HR and Payroll related matters. Independently researches and resolves inquiries, demonstrating a high degree of responsiveness, accuracy and integrity. Actions to resolve inquiries may frequently require engagement of internal resources from various departments as well as external vendors, service providers and/or consultants Prepares and executes pre-payroll audit reviews to assure compliance with stated policies and procedures Coordinates Technical Payroll to confirm and reconcile forecasted payroll results each pay period. Oversight of gross payroll ranging from $800k – $900k per processing period Assists in development of management reporting requirements; prepares, audits and issues recurring and ad-hoc reports from various systems Participates in special projects / project teams as required
